The NBA Cup 2026 will start with two great games: LeBron against the Knicks and Doncic against the Warriors
New York Knicks, current NBA champions, will face the King James' Sixers, while the Lakers will visit Golden State.
The NBA Cup 2026 already has a schedule and will kick off with some of the most attractive matchups that the competition can currently offer. The reigning NBA champions, New York Knicks, will face LeBron James' Philadelphia 76ers, while the Los Angeles Lakers will visit the Golden State Warriors on a first day that will capture much of the spotlight.
The NBA announced the complete schedule of the NBA Cup this Wednesday, along with the 15 games to be broadcast nationally on ESPN, Prime Video, or NBC/Peacock. The tournament will once again occupy much of the calendar throughout November before reaching its decisive rounds in December.
The Knicks will start their title defense against the Sixers
The highlight of the first day will be the duel between New York Knicks and Philadelphia 76ers, scheduled for October 30th. It will be the second matchup between these two teams in just ten days, after the NBA announced that the Knicks will host Philadelphia on October 20th during the season's opening day.
The game will also have a special element with the presence of LeBron James, who decided to join the Sixers as a free agent to face a final stage of his career with the aim of winning another championship.
The Knicks arrive as the major actors of the previous season. The New York team first won the NBA Cup and then ended a drought of 53 years without winning the NBA championship.
Therefore, the NBA has decided that the Knicks will raise their champions' banner on the opening night of the season, on October 20th, against Philadelphia.
The New York team defeated the San Antonio Spurs in both the NBA Cup final and later in the NBA Finals. Despite winning the tournament the previous season, the Knicks became the first competition's champion not to hang a banner to commemorate the title.

What will the format of the NBA Cup 2026 be like?
The NBA Cup will be divided into six groups that were announced last June. Each team will play their matches in the group stage, and the top team from each group will earn a spot in the quarter-finals.
They will be joined by one wildcard team from each conference, making it eight teams continuing in the competition.
The quarter-finals will take place on December 4th and 5th, while the semifinals are scheduled for December 8th and 9th.
The grand final will be held on December 11th at the Hinkle Fieldhouse in Indianapolis, the chosen venue for hosting the competition's ultimate game.
| Phase | Date |
|---|---|
| Opening day | October 30th |
| Group stage | October 30th - November 27th |
| Additional matches | November 24th and 25th |
| Quarter-finals | December 4th and 5th |
| Semifinals | December 8th and 9th |
| Final | December 11th |
| Final venue | Hinkle Fieldhouse, Indianapolis |

Lakers and Bucks already know what it's like to win the competition
The NBA Cup will celebrate its fourth edition in 2026 since its inception.
The Los Angeles Lakers were the first champions of the competition in 2023 when the tournament was still known simply as the regular season tournament.
A year later, the Milwaukee Bucks claimed the 2024 title. The Knicks took the most recent edition after a historic season where they also ultimately clinched the NBA championship.
